                        Part III-Narrative

The Company purchased 100% of the oustanding stock of Hawaii Reservations
Center Corp. on April 30, 2000 and is in the process of finalizing the
balance sheet of Hawaii Reservations Center Corp. so that it can be
consolidated with the Company.  The Company shall file form 10-QSB for
the nine months ended April 30, 2000 within five calendar days (by June
19, 2000).
